Hotel IMLAUER & Bräu
10/10 Excellent
"We had a wonderful stay at the hotel. Everything was clean and tidy; the staff were very friendly; our room had everything we needed; the shower was particularly good; there was plenty of very nice food at breakfast. We liked very much that the hotel gives a €5 voucher for any day you don’t have your room cleaned. This could then be spent in the bar or restaurant - what a great idea! The hotel is in a good location, handy for trains and many bus lines. Our room overlooked the street which was a bit noisy with the windows open; but once they were shut we couldn’t hear anything. The extra tax that the city charges (currently 50c per person per night) to then provide a Guest Mobility ticket was fabulous. We got the train to Werfen and Zell am See; the bus to Bad Ischl and Hellbrunn Palace; and various buses and trams round the city and it cost us nothing at all with our Guest Mobility ticket. I would have no hesitation recommending this hotel to anyone planning to visit Salzburg."
